This work is of the highest scholarly and, at the same time, practical value (which is extremely rare ): It certainly opens up a new era in the research and use of the lira da braccio." -- RIdIM/RCMI Newsletter "Sterling Scott Jone's exceptional book is... welcome as a practical study of the instrument, with its emphasis on iconography, and with its fingering charts, tuning instructions and playable musical examples." -- The Consort: European Journal of Early Music The 16th-century lira da braccio may be the missing link between the medieval fiddle and the modern violin. This is a brief history of the lira da braccio, a handbook for its use, and selected repertoire.
